- Eka WibowoMar 12, 2021 · 5 years agoResidual interest refers to the ownership claim on the net assets of a digital currency company after deducting liabilities. It represents the portion of the company's assets that belongs to the shareholders or owners. The residual interest is calculated by subtracting the total liabilities from the total assets. It is an important indicator of the company's financial health and the value that shareholders hold. A higher residual interest indicates a stronger financial position and a greater value for shareholders.
